In an era when the railroad was the backbone of American industry, "The Young Train Master" by Burton Egbert Stevenson captures the thrilling ascent of Allan West, a determined young man navigating the complexities of the railway system. As he rises to the role of chief dispatcher for the Ohio Division of the P. & O. railway, readers are immersed in the challenges and triumphs of a profession that demanded precision and courage. With vivid depictions of train operations and the intricate dynamics of teamwork, this novel explores themes of ambition and responsibility. Ideal for students and historians alike, this compelling narrative offers a unique glimpse into the world of early 20th-century railroads and the lives intertwined with them.
